Configure a snapshot action

A snapshot action records the values of a selected mix of analog, discrete, and string tags at the time that the event occurred.

To configure a snapshot action

  1. In the Action Type list, select Snapshot.

    Configuring a snapshot action

    All tags included in the snapshot are listed in the Snapshot Tag List list. Snapshots can include analog, discrete, and string tags.

  2. To add one or more tags, click Add. The Tag Finder dialog box appears, in which you can query the database for tags. For more information, see Use the tag finder.

  3. To delete a tag, select the tag in the Snapshot Tag List list and then click Delete.

  4. (Optional) In the Post Detector Delay box, type the amount of time, in milliseconds, that must elapse after an event is detected before the event action can be executed.
